First Year ABA Schedule:
Age of child 4.5 to 5 years of age.
Number of Therapists:
4 therapists.
Number of hours:
40 hour weekly schedule Monday-
occasional Saturdays.
Included in the 40hours schedule: 12.5 hours of preschool with a shadow from
our program (two of our tutors
shadowed), 2-4 hours of community outings, 5 hours of play dates or playground
or “lets search the park for a group of kids” type stuff.
Towards the end of the preschool school year, the shadows
were pulling back and he attended several days by himself. He had a very supportive preschool teacher.
Summer before Kindergarten
Age of Child: 5.5
years.
Number of therapists:
4 therapists
Number of hours:
40hrs Monday- Friday to include 6 hours of play group, library
story hour at two different libraries,
5 hours of community trips.
Kindergarten
August 2000-December 2000
Age of child : 6
years
Number of Therapists : 5
Number of hours:
32 hours of kindergarten with a shadow
L
7 hours of afterschool ABA plus 3 hours of community trips looking for kids to
play with, etc.
Kindergarten
January- May 2001
Age of Child :
6.5 years.
Number of hours : 50 hours.
Number of therapists: 5
We pulled our child from his “hellish” kindergarten class
with an unsupportive teacher and an unsupportive principal. He was now homeschooled. The 50hrs included 6 hours week of supervised play dates, 2 hours a week of Garden Club,
3 hours of Italian School with shadow, 2 hours of Sunday School without shadow,
1 hour of junior choir without shadow, 1 hour a week of
soccer with shadow, 6-8 hours of community outings, and the rest were ABA
sessions done throughout the house. We had wonderful improvements during this
time.
May 2001-August 2001
Age of Child: 6.5 years
Number of Therapists:
2 therapists
Activities included:
zoo camp, art camp, story/craft
time at the library 2 hours a week, 5 hours of community outings, Bible
school, 5-7 hrs of play dates when we
could get them, and 1:1 aba done throughout the house, community, etc.
August 2001
Age of child almost 7
Number of therapists: 2
32 hrs a week with a shadow in a 1st grade
teacher who WAS VERY VERY VERY SUPPORTIVE.
The shadow immediately began fading because this was such a WONDERFUL
teacher, 1 hr week of swim lessons, 3
hrs of Italian School, and about 5 hours of ABA, and 5 hrs of play dates.
September 2001-May 2002:
Age of child: 7 years.
Number of Therapists 2 (we added a third MALE therapist
in Feb-May)
He was attending first grade shadowless for 32 hrs per
week! Hooray!!!
3 hours of Italian School with Shadow (who was there more
for observation to look at social skills we needed to work on)
1 hr of swim lessons with a shadow spying J She happened to be a swim instructor so we
enrolled him in her class.
5 hours a week of “guy things” with the male tutor to
include extreme sports, rock climbing, kite flying, tree climbing.
6 hours a week of ABA.
Any peer interaction we could get (varied from 5-10hrs a week)
June 2002
No ABA. Just
mom. Number of therapists: 0
Activities: art camp , zoo camp, and a HUGE family
vacation, bible school.
He plays with kids in the neighbourhood when they are
out, I occasionally call one buddy from
his first grade for a play date.
Plan for fall 2002:
Second grade- no shadow.
Swim lessons- no shadow.
Italian School-
no shadow
Try and foster more peer relationships by inviting peers
over.
